“Suck It Up, Buttercup”: Understanding and Overcoming Gender Disparities in Policing
Bibliographic record
Abstract
Women police officers report elevated symptoms of mental disorders when compared to men police officers. Researchers have indicated that the occupational experience of policing differs greatly among men and women. Indeed, police culture is characterized by hegemonic masculinity, which appears to negatively impact both men and women. The current study examined the contrast between the experiences of men and women police officers. Police officers (n = 17; 9 women) in Saskatchewan participated in semi-structured interviews. Thematic network analysis identified themes related to the experience of policing for both men and women police officers. There were six organizing themes identified in relation to the global theme of Gendered Experiences: (1) Discrimination; (2) Sexual Harassment; (3) Motherhood and Parental Leave; (4) Identity; (5) Stereotypically Feminine Attributes; and (6) Hegemonic Masculinity. Pervasive gender norms appear detrimental for both men and women police officers, as well as the communities they serve. The current results, coupled with the emerging disposition for progress expressed by police services, offer opportunities to develop tailored and focused interventions and policies to support police officers.
